Transaction 7592941cdb1557577faa32bc966d4404b826e3a5dadd69857353b73f993ba1b6
2 Input
2 Outputs
- 7592941cdb1557577faa32bc966d4404b826e3a5dadd69857353b73f993ba1b6:0
- 7592941cdb1557577faa32bc966d4404b826e3a5dadd69857353b73f993ba1b6:1
value 505754
address 17n7AAqvtSascR7uARER998ywqwENeECan
value 544272
address 366B1ar3BUmbUQFGJAE994J173fGscgjw8